Hansi Flick is orchestrating a captivating transformation at FC Barcelona. Since stepping into the managerial role last year, succeeding the revered Xavi Hernandez, the German maestro has undeniably injected a fresh dynamism into the Catalan giants, positioning them for what could be a truly memorable season.
The silverware already gleams in the Camp Nou trophy cabinet, with Barcelona having secured both the Spanish Super Cup and the Copa del Rey titles this campaign. Their dominance extends to the La Liga arena, where they currently sit comfortably four points ahead of their arch-rivals, Real Madrid, demonstrating a consistency and tactical prowess under Flick’s guidance.
Furthermore, Barcelona’s resurgence under Flick has been evident on the European stage. They navigated a challenging Champions League journey to reach the semi-finals, where a thrilling 3-3 draw in the first leg against Inter Milan last night showcased their attacking firepower and resilience.
Reward for Success: Contract Extension on the Horizon
The remarkable impact of Hansi Flick has not gone unnoticed by the Barcelona hierarchy. Keen to secure his long-term future at the club, they have been actively pursuing a renewal of his contract, which currently runs until 2026.
Recent reports have indicated that an agreement in principle to extend his tenure until 2027 is already in place, with only a few remaining details requiring finalization. Now, according to a report from Mundo Deportivo, Barcelona are aiming to officially conclude Flick’s contract extension in the crucial days following the Champions League semi-final second leg against Inter Milan next Tuesday. This strategic timing also places the finalization just ahead of the highly anticipated El Clasico clash against Real Madrid, scheduled for Sunday, May 11th at Montjuic.
El Clasico Summit: Agent Meeting Planned
The significance of El Clasico extends beyond the pitch, often attracting prominent figures from the global football fraternity. The upcoming edition will be no different, with Pini Zahavi, Hansi Flick’s influential agent and also the representative of Barcelona’s star striker Robert Lewandowski, expected to be in attendance in Barcelona for the monumental fixture.
The Mundo Deportivo report further reveals that Zahavi and his associates will leverage this opportunity to hold a crucial in-person meeting with Barcelona’s sporting leadership. The primary objective of this meeting will be to iron out the final terms and conditions of Hansi Flick’s new contract, paving the way for its imminent signing.
The anticipated agreement will see Flick’s commitment to Barcelona extended through the 2027 season. Interestingly, the contract will not include any additional option year, reflecting Flick’s preference for a season-by-season evaluation of his projects, allowing for flexibility and mutual agreement on future steps.
Strategic Announcement Timing
While the contract extension is expected to be finalized and ready for signatures in the coming week, Barcelona are reportedly planning a more strategic approach to the official announcement.
The club intends to carefully select the opportune moment to make the news public. This timing is likely to coincide with a significant milestone, such as the decisive outcome of the La Liga title race. Alternatively, should Barcelona progress to the Champions League final, the announcement could be strategically timed in the lead-up to that prestigious fixture, maximizing the positive impact and celebratory atmosphere surrounding Flick’s continued leadership.
